After reading several statements on your website regarding ACV & hemorrhoids, I tried it. After all, I drink the stuff and I truly believe in it's healing properties. However, I applied the ACV using a q-tip to the area where I had the hemorrhoids and I developed a very painful rash on the inner part of my buttocks, both sides! I wouldn't recommend it for hemorrhoid treatment, but it is good stuff otherwise!
